Inflammation Fighter
Ginger is renowned for its anti-inflammatory effects. It contains compounds that inhibit the production of inflammatory substances in the body, such as prostaglandins and leukotrienes. This makes ginger helpful for managing various inflammatory conditions, including arthritis and muscle soreness. Its anti-inflammatory properties also aid in reducing pain. Raw ginger can alleviate symptoms of conditions such as migraines and other inflammatory disorders. The regular intake of ginger can reduce inflammation throughout the body, improving overall health and reducing the risk of chronic diseases.
Digestive Health Support
Raw ginger benefits the digestive system. It can alleviate nausea and vomiting, making it a natural remedy for morning sickness, chemotherapy-induced nausea, and motion sickness. Ginger can also speed up gastric emptying, preventing bloating and indigestion. Furthermore, ginger stimulates the production of digestive enzymes, which enhances nutrient absorption. Raw ginger can reduce gut inflammation and promote a healthy gut microbiome, improving digestion and reducing the risk of digestive issues like irritable bowel syndrome.
